Old New York In Photos #159 – North Of Central Park 1871

Paving The Road North Of Central Park

This barren scene is Sixth Avenue (renamed Lenox Avenue in 1887 and additionally named Malcom X Boulevard in 1987) just north of Central Park.

As the northern boundary of the city kept expanding the grading and opening of streets continued further north.

The photograph by Rockwood is dated 1871. Two of the steamrollers appear to be providing their own locomotion without  horses.

Within 20 years this area would be completely filled with apartment houses and private homes.
